Paperback. Condición: New. Print on Demand. This book incisively analyzes the corrosive effects of covetousness, a vice that has plagued humanity since ancient times. The author carefully traces its insidious operations, from its small, seemingly insignificant manifestations to its destructive societal consequences. Coveteousnes…s, the author argues, is fundamentally irrational, leading to personal and communal ruin. By examining scriptural passages and historical examples, the book demonstrates how covetousness distorts our values, undermines relationships, and hinders spiritual growth. The author emphasizes that this destructive force can manifest in various guises, even among those who profess Christian beliefs. Exploring the Î Î Î lical condemnation of covetousness and its devastating impact throughout history, this book offers a timely warning against a vice that continues to cripple individuals and societies today. Through its profound insights, this book equips readers to recognize and combat covetousness in their own lives and work toward a more just and compassionate world.
